Stamp Duty
Last in this run of property blogs, I thought I would explain about Stamp Duty. Stamp Duty is a tax that you pay each time that you buy a property as your main residence above £125,000. Politicians are constantly changing the rules depending on who they are trying to win votes from! The latest winners are